Understanding BBQ Beef Short Ribs Recipe: Unveiling the Classic
BBQ Beef Short Ribs, often simply referred to as “short ribs,” are a cut of beef consisting of several small bones connected by tender meat. The term ‘short rib’ derives from its relatively short length compared to other rib cuts. This specific cut is renowned for its rich marbling and robust flavor, making it an ideal candidate for slow-cooking methods like barbecue.
The recipe typically involves a long, slow cooking process, allowing the collagen in the meat to break down and transform into gelatin, resulting in incredibly tender short ribs. Barbecue offers a unique opportunity to infuse these ribs with a wide array of flavors through smoke, sauces, and spices. This ancient cooking technique has been passed down through generations, evolving and adapting to various culinary traditions worldwide.
Core Components:
- Beef Short Ribs: The star of the dish, chosen for their marbling and tenderness.
- Barbecue Sauce: A key flavor enhancer, ranging from sweet and tangy to savory and spicy.
- Smokiness: Achieved through smoking the ribs over wood chips or chunks, imparting a distinct aroma and taste.
- Spices and Herbs: Used to season the ribs before and during cooking, adding depth and complexity.
- Slow Cooking Method: Essential for breaking down connective tissues and collagen.
Global Impact and Trends: A Culinary Journey
BBQ Beef Short Ribs have transcended geographical boundaries, leaving an indelible mark on global culinary landscapes. This dish has evolved and adapted to local tastes and traditions, giving rise to a diverse range of interpretations:
- American Barbecue: In the United States, short ribs are often slow-cooked over hardwood coals, such as oak or hickory, resulting in a smoky, mouthwatering delicacy. Texas-style barbecue features brisket and ribs, with a focus on long, slow cooking.
- Caribbean Fusion: The Caribbean islands have embraced short ribs, infusing them with local spices and flavors like allspice, scotch bonnet peppers, and mango chutney.
- Asian Influences: In East Asia, short ribs are sometimes marinated in soy sauce, mirin, and ginger before cooking, offering a sweet and savory profile. Korean BBQ ribs, or ‘galbi,’ are a famous example, grilled over hot coals.
- European Twists: European countries like England and France have their versions, often featuring rich braises with red wine and herbs. The French may pair them with a rich red wine sauce.
These global trends showcase the versatility of BBQ Beef Short Ribs, highlighting how cultural diversity enriches culinary experiences.

Mastering the Cooking Technique: Slow Cooking for Perfection
The key to tender, flavorful BBQ Beef Short Ribs lies in the slow cooking process:
- Preparation: Start by seasoning the ribs generously with salt, pepper, and your choice of spices. Let them come to room temperature before cooking.
- Slow Cooking: Use a slow cooker or oven at low temperatures (around 250°F/120°C) for 6-8 hours, allowing the meat to slowly render its fat and gelatin.
- Smoke Addition: For an authentic barbecue flavor, add wood chips or chunks (hickory, mesquite, or applewood are popular choices) after a few hours of cooking. Smoke at low temperatures to prevent burning.
- Resting Time: After cooking, let the ribs rest for 15-20 minutes before slicing. This step ensures that juices redistribute throughout the meat.
Sauces and Toppings: Unlocking Flavor Potential
Barbecue sauces play a pivotal role in enhancing the taste of BBQ Beef Short Ribs. Here’s how to use them effectively:
- Basics: Start with a classic barbecue sauce made from ketchup, vinegar, brown sugar, garlic, and spices. Adjust the sweetness and tanginess to your preference.
- Variations: Explore different sauces like molasses-based, mustard-infused, or even fruit-based options for a tropical twist.
- Application: Brush on the sauce during the last 30 minutes of cooking for a glistening finish. Alternatively, serve extra sauce on the side for those who like to dip.
- Toppings: Crushed red pepper flakes, chopped scallions, or fresh herbs add texture and flavor.
